WebThe meaning of THIOCYANIC ACID is an unstable liquid acid HSCN or HNCS of strong odor that is usually obtained by distilling a thiocyanate salt with dilute sulfuric acid and that polymerizes readily. This table shows how … WebCopper (I) Thiocyanate is used in flame retardants for PVC plastics, protective antifouling marine coatings, and the electrodes of some batteries. Thin films of copper (I) thiocyanate are highly transparent and exhibit a wide band gap, giving it use in fabricating thin film transistors, acting as a hole-transport material for perovskite solar ...
